Mobile Panel 277 IWLAN升级介绍
上图Mobile Panel 277 IWLAN停产后西门子官方推荐的替换方式:
有线方式:KTP900 Mobile触摸屏
无线方式:工业平板电脑ITP1000
由于我们的无线触摸屏是放在配料小车的,不方便走线,只能选择使用ITP1000,另需要购买Wincc RuntimeAdvanced软件。
以成本考虑的话,也可以选择其他一些平板设备,只要是Window系统版本支持相应的Wincc RuntimeAdvanced就可以了。
我们这里使用的是Win10 + Wincc RuntimeAdvanced V15.1
西门子ITP平板型号6AV7676-1AB00-0AA0说明:
ITP1000 屏幕大小10.1‘’ 分辨率1280x800,256固态硬盘,Win10 LTSB 201664位系统,处理器为I5-6442EQ,可选配摄像头、RFID读卡器、条码阅读器(我们这里都没选),使用的是外接的USB型的Datalogic扫码枪。
注意:
底座Docking Station不在标准清单里面的,需要采购,型号为
6AV7676-1AB00-0AA0
接口方面:1个网口,2个USB口,1个串口,1个MiniDP头,1个SD卡槽都在上面。如我们使用外接的USB扫码枪就会导致容易进灰。1个USBType C和充电口在左侧面。
上面只是介绍我们采购型号的配置,其他配置请去官网或联系供应商选配。
升级步骤
1、安装NET Framework3.5 Sp1
Wincc Runtime Advanced需要NET Framework3.5 Sp1环境,安装方式:
可以在Win10的启用或关闭Windows功能中安装(速度比较慢)
离线安装,下载离线安装包,下载后安装,大小231.5 MB
离线包放在Zui后网盘中
2、安装Wincc Runtime Advanced V15.1和授权
在安装软件前将正版授权的U盘插入平板后,在安装完成后自动将授权导入到电脑中。当然也可以安装完成后通过AutomationLicense Manager手动安装U盘中的授权。
学习目的的话可以使用Sim_EKB来安装授权。搜下就知道了。
3、修改程序
使用TIAV15.1更改硬件设备,调整好所有画面的分辨率、画面中每个控件的位置、修改驱动的连接、在变量管理器中修改相应的驱动连接名称等。
注意:由于我们Wincc RuntimeAdvanced使用的是V15.1版本的,我们的TIA博图编程软件也需要是V15.1的。
4、下载程序
程序修完完成后设置好ITP的IP地址,打开WinCC RuntimeLoader软件,切换到Transfer(传输)模式,上位电脑就可以搜索到设备并下载程序了。
如果搜索不到请ping下平板的网络IP地址,ping不通时请关闭平板的防火墙。
5、设置开机启动项
将Wincc Runtime Loader设置为开机启动,注意显示隐藏的目录,否则下面路径下的文件夹会看不到。
问题
1、USB扫码枪无法正确完整扫码
与系统输入法有关系,我们在设置系统的时选的默认输入法是中文的,删除中文输入法改成默认为英文的输入法后就可以正常扫码了
2、触摸屏的输入输出域无法自动弹出输入键盘
常规的触摸屏,我们使用的是触摸屏软件自带的键盘,在运行系统设置>键盘>使用屏幕键盘是默认勾选的,不能取消。在更改了触摸屏的硬件为ITP1000后,使用屏幕键盘默认是不勾选的。我们需要手动把它勾选上。
话外:
一般gaoji语言开发的上位机为了使界面风格一致以及可以触摸使用,都会自己做一个纯数字输入键盘和软键盘。有的键盘程序是用的模态窗口(对话窗口)来做的,即全部输入完成按Enter后,会将输入的所有值拼接成一个字符串作为模态窗口的结果值来传送给输入框。而西门子触摸屏自带的键盘使用的不是模态窗口,且在输入的会实时显示输入的值在输入框中。
3、菜单行里的控件无法显示
检查后发现是因为按钮的Y轴的值超过了画面的范围为负值,只要控件有一点超出画面范围,整个控件就会都不显示。
在布局窗口可以整体检查每页超过范围的控件。